The first thing that’s been confirmed for the EPCOT Flower and Garden Festival are the dates. The 2025 EPCOT Flower and Garden Festival will start on March 5th and run through June 2nd. This year’s event is also celebrating a huge milestone: it’s the 30th anniversary of the festival. That’s a pretty big deal!
Of course, we’re really excited about THE FOOD at The EPCOT Flower and Garden Festival. Disney has confirmed the Outdoor Kitchens will return to this year’s festival, but we haven’t seen which kitchens have been confirmed and what their menus will look like.
Disney also confirmed the return of the beautiful topiaries of Disney characters, gardens (including the butterfly garden), and unique exhibits. We don’t know what kinds of character topiaries will be featured this year (and we’re certain there will be some NEW ones), but we can’t wait to see them!
Disney has also announced that the Garden Rocks concert series will be returning to this festival this year. Garden Rocks is held at the America Gardens Theater in the America Adventure Pavilion. These concerts are free with EPCOT admission with showtimes usually at 5:30 PM, 6:45 PM, and 8 PM. Here’s the full line-up of acts for 2025:
- March 7th-8th – Tommy DeCarlo, former lead singer of Boston
- March 9th-10th – Air Supply – 50th Anniversary Celebration
- March 14th-15th – Blue October
- March 16th-17th – Rick Springfield
- March 21st-22nd – Herman’s Hermits starring Peter Noone
- March 23rd-24th – 38 Special
- March 28th-29th – Jason Scheff, longtime singer of Chicago
- March 30th-31st – TBD
- April 4th-5th – THE ORCHESTRA Starring ELO and ELO Part II Former Members
- April 6th-7th – Sugar Ray
- April 11th-12th – Simple Plan
- April 13th-14th – Jo Dee Messina
- April 18th-19th – Mike DelGuidice
- April 20th-21st – A Flock of Seagulls
- April 25th-26th – Taylor Dayne
- April 27th-28th – 98 Degrees
- May 2nd-5th – Plain White T’s
- May 9th-10th – Jon Secada
- May 11th-12th – Maverick City Music (NEW)
- May 16th-17th – The Spinners
- May 18th-19th – The Pointer Sisters
- May 23rd-24th – The Outlaws (NEW)
- May 25th-26th – Don Felder, formerly of the Eagles
- May 30th-31st – The Cat Empire (NEW)
- June 1st-2nd – We The Kingdom (NEW)
Reservations are now open for the Garden Rocks Concert Series Dining Packages. These packages let you have a table service meal at a participating restaurant and get a reserved seat for one of the shows. The festival’s TWO scavenger hunts are coming back. First, you’ll be able to participate in Spike’s Pollen-Nation Exploration, which will have you following Spike the Bee throughout EPCOT. The Egg-Stravaganza Hunt will also return around Easter time, which will task you with finding character eggs throughout EPCOT. You’ll be able to pick up maps (for usually around $10) at EPCOT shops. Once you’re done filling in the maps with stickers, you get a prize.
You’ll also be able to get some special photo ops through Disney PhotoPass, including special Magic Shots. Plus, you can get mini festival gift cards with a unique festival design (these are great if you want to budget your festival purchases).
